Been to many dealerships in my life time, and never had an issue. At Parkway Chevrolet, I had the worse experience of my life. Let me test drive the vehicle I came there to buy (New 2016 High Country), then when I went to purchase it, said the person that got there before me is buying it. Said I should have held on to the keys. How could I have held on to the keys when you asked for them back?? Then put me in a 2016 used High Country that had been in a accident but never disclosed it. I found the paperwork in the glove box from Auto Check after I purchased it and got home. Came back to dealership about not only the accident it was involved in, but also had vibration when sitting at a stop sign or signal light, and had holes drilled below the steering wheel. Addressed these items with them and they said they could not fix anything, so I asked for my vehicles back that I traded in. Salesman said they were already sold and gone to highest bidder, which I found out 3 weeks later that that was a lie. Found my car on there website for sale 3 weeks later?? Anyway they said I had to keep that High country or trade up to 2017, cause they had no more 2016's, turned out to be another lie. So I was railroaded into a 2017 Silverado LTZ at a much higher cost and note at $109 more than the High Country. Dealership was a complete rip off.
